> > HELP !
> > I've tried everything I can think of and I'm at a loss.
> >
> > Setup:
> > alsa 0.9.0rc2
> > soundcard Terratec EWS88 (ice1712 driver)
> > direct hw:0,0 using snd_pcm_readi & writei with descriptor polling.
> > length approx 50s similtaneous read & write. read from all channels.
> > modified 'envy24setup' to preset hardware levels on startup
> > full restart of sound system each 'pass' (new handles etc.)
> >
> > Problem:
> > The first pass works fine with beautiful audio.
> > The next pass the output is badly distorted (sounds like an incomplete
> > buffer or something), but
> > no errors reported, no under/overruns.... only evidence that something
> > is wrong is to listen to it.
> >
> > What fixes it:
> > Waiting. Yup...if I wait > 1 minute before the 2nd pass then that is
> > also fine. Something 'happens'
> > in that time to make it all ok again.
> > This is why it's taken me ages to actually notice the problem at all !
> > (program has been running
> > for months).
> >
> > What *doesn't* help:
> > Not doing a full sound restart between passes (ie. merely doing a drop
> > afterwards, then restart with
> > prepare & start, leaving pcm handles alive).
> > Playing a wav file with 'aplay' in between passes.
> > Exiting from my program and starting again between passes.
> > adding hw_free commands prior to close of the in & out handles.

> Here is the code segment in question. The periodsize is setup to be 1/4
> of the buffersize which is set
> to the maximum the soundcard will give me. When restarting the soundcard
> is initialised from scratch
> (new fd's), but I tried without doing this and it makes no difference):
> 
>         /* Get one full width buffer, buffersize is in frames. */
>         outbuf = (char *)calloc(out_buffer_size * OUTCH,
> snd_pcm_format_width(format) / 8);
>                 /* calloc since we want silence initially on output */
>         inbuf = (char *)calloc(in_buffer_size * INCH,
> snd_pcm_format_width(format) / 8);
> 
>         /* Start the ball rolling */
>         snd_pcm_prepare(outhand);
>         snd_pcm_prepare(inhand);
>         snd_pcm_reset(outhand);
>         snd_pcm_reset(inhand);
>         snd_pcm_start(inhand);
> 
>         /* This is the IO loop */
>         outp = a buffer that contains what I want to output;
>         outl = length of said buffer;
>         outs = (QUIET * (Fs/1000));     /* Pre-silence output time */
>         Delay *= Fs;                    /* Change to sample count */
>         Delay += QUIET * (Fs/1000);     /* Always delay the output quiet period as
> well */
>         dc = Delay;
>         samps = N;
>         ocopy = 0;
>         /* inptrs already point to fmptrs */
>         for(;;)
>         {
>                 if(outs)
>                         out = outs;
>                 else
>                 {
>                         if(outl)
>                         {
>                                 if( ocopy == 0 )
>                                 {
>                                         ocopy = 1;
>                                         /* Copy from single channel full buffer to 
>full width one */
>                                         sampl = (long *)outp;
>                                         sampm = (long *)outbuf;
> 
>                                         for(x=0; x < out_buffer_size; x++)
>                                         {
>                                                 /* only 2 channels output (180 deg 
>out of phase) */
>                                                 *sampm = *sampl++;
>                                                 sampm += OUTCH;          /* Skip 
>over other output channels */
>                                                 if( x > outl )
>                                                         break;
>                                         }
>                                         out = outl;
>                                 }
>                         }
>                         else
>                                 out = out_buffer_size;          /* Silence after */
>                 }
> 
>                 /* See if ready for output data yet */
>                 poll(outfds, ocount, -1);
>                 snd_pcm_poll_descriptors_revents(outhand, outfds, ocount,
> &revents);
>                 if (revents & POLLERR)
>                 {
>                         fprintf(stderr, "Tx Poll failed\n");
>                         err = -1;
>                         break;
>                 }
>                 if (revents & POLLOUT)
>                 {
>                         err = snd_pcm_writei(outhand, (void *)outbuf, out > 
>out_buffer_size ?
> out_buffer_size  : out );
>                         if( err < 0 )
>                         {
>                                 /* EAGAIN Shouldn't happen now since we're polling 
>first */
>                                 if( err != -EAGAIN )
>                                 {
>                                         fprintf(stderr, "Write failed %s", 
>snd_strerror(err));
>                                         break;
>                                 }
>                         }
>                         else
>                         {
>                                 if(outs)
>                                         outs -= err;
>                                 else
>                                 {
>                                         if(outl)
>                                         {
>                                                 outl -= err;
>                                                 outp += err * 
>snd_pcm_format_width(format)/8;
>                                                 ocopy = 0;
>                                                 if( outl == 0 )
>                                                 {
>                                                         /* Finished actual output. 
>Now fill buffer with silence again */
>                                                         sampm = (long *)outbuf;
>                                                         for(x=0; x < 
>out_buffer_size; x++)
>                                                         {
>                                                                 *sampm++ = 0;
>                                                                 *sampm = 0;
>                                                                 sampm += OUTCH-1; /* 
>Skip over other output channels */
>                                                         }
>                                                 }
>                                         }
>                                 }
>                         }
>                 }
> 
>                 /* See if data ready to be read yet... we started sampling earlier. 
>*/
>                 poll(infds, icount, -1);
>                 snd_pcm_poll_descriptors_revents(inhand, infds, icount,
> &revents);
>                 if (revents & POLLERR)
>                 {
>                         fprintf(stderr, "Rx Poll failed\n");
>                         err = -1;
>                         break;
>                 }
>                 if( !((revents & POLLIN) || (revents & POLLPRI)) )
>                         continue;
> 
>                 if(dc)
>                 {
>                         err = snd_pcm_readi(inhand, inbuf, dc > in_buffer_size ?
> in_buffer_size : dc);
>                         if(err < 0)
>                         {
>                                 if( err != -EAGAIN )
>                                 {
>                                         fprintf(stderr,"Read error at %ld: %s\n", 
>Delay-dc,
> snd_strerror(err));
>                                         break;
>                                 }
>                         }
>                         else
>                         {
>                                 dc -= err;
>                                 if( dc )
>                                         continue;
>                         }
>                 }
> 
>                 /* Finally actually record some real stuff */
>                 err = snd_pcm_readi(inhand, inbuf, samps > in_buffer_size ?
> in_buffer_size : samps);
>                 if(err < 0)
>                 {
>                         if( err != -EAGAIN )
>                         {
>                                 /* No point in underrun recovery in this application 
>so abort */
>                                 fprintf(stderr,"Read error at %ld: %s\n", N-samps,
> snd_strerror(err));
>                                 break;
>                         }
>                 }
>                 else
>                 {
>                         samps -= err;
>                         /* Copy from full width buffer to channels */
>                         for(y=0; y < channels; y++)
>                         {
>                                 sampl = (long *)inbuf + y;
>                                 sampm = (long *)inptrs[y];
>                                 for(x=0; x < err; x++)
>                                 {
>                                         *sampm++ = *sampl;
>                                         sampl += INCH;
>                                 }
>                                 inptrs[y] += err * snd_pcm_format_width(format)/8;
>                         }
>                         if( samps <= 0 )
>                                 break;
>                 }
>         }
>         fprintf(stderr,"Sampling Completed\n");
>         snd_pcm_unlink(outhand);
>         snd_pcm_drop(outhand);
>         snd_pcm_drop(inhand);
>         snd_pcm_hw_free(outhand);
>         snd_pcm_close(outhand);
>         snd_pcm_hw_free(inhand);
>         snd_pcm_close(inhand);
> 
>         /* Free up temporary memory */
>         free(inbuf); free(outbuf);
